    Running sfc /scannow under the control of RB-RX

    Over at the HDS forum the user dbolotin reported that running sfc /scannow he got an error which prevented Windows from being updated. Since I do not want to register at the HDS forum I am bringing it up here...

    I believe that it is bad idea to run sfc /scannow under a RB-RX protected OS. This command will not just analyze system files problems, it will also actively try to fix them. This is very similar to running chkdsk /f under RB-RX.

    Out of curiosity I did run sfc /scannow under Win7-64 running Rollback RX 10.7. Chkdsk reported no problems for the protected partition. sfc /scannow did its thing, at the end it reported that errors were found, but could not be fixed. I went over the huge log file, and in the last line it said that everything was fine, all operations had been successful. To me this looks like after the analyzing process the Rollback driver successfully prevented all attempts to fix any detected problems. This would be a good thing IMO. So I just ignored the sfc /scannow report, chkdsk still does not find any problems.

    BTW I have been running the latest v. 10.7 build of RB-RX for a long time now and never got any corruption problems.
